Hasidic Jews and the Amish wear similar clothes. The men grow long beards, the women dress modestly, and both groups speak a dialect of old German. But the Amish are devout Christians while Hasidim are devout Jews. An unbridgeable gap?
The Rumspringa Kallah (Bride) is the story of a Hasidic boy who is unable to find a wife within his own community because of a thorny problem with his status in Jewish law. Undaunted, he seeks a solution among the Amish. He will try to find a good Amish girl to be his soulmate - with one caveat. In order to marry him, she must convert to Judaism.
The road is long and full of twists, but ultimately his gambit works beyond his wildest dreams. The curse on his head in the Hasidic Jewish community turns into great blessing.
This emotionally-charged story takes an intriguing look into both the human heart and the mysterious workings of Divine Providence. As in Sender Zeyv's other novels, The Rumspringa Kallah contains a wealth of knowledge: Jewish marriage and divorce, Hasidic and Amish customs and, most notably, scholarly challenges to Christian theology.
